Common Questions

2002 DODGE CARAVAN FAQ

How many recalls does a 2002 Dodge Caravan have?

The 2002 Dodge Caravan has 10 recalls on record with NHTSA. Always verify current recall status at nhtsa.gov before purchasing.

What is the fuel economy of a 2002 Dodge Caravan?

The 2002 Dodge Caravan gets 18–20 MPG combined depending on trim level and drivetrain configuration.

What is the best 2002 Dodge Caravan trim to buy used?

Based on MyCar Score™ ratings, the eC trim scores highest at 59.9 out of 100, balancing value, fuel economy, and specifications.
